查看文章
 
PNG24和PNG32之间的不同
2009-09-04 13:49

在做浏览器skin的时候突然意识到PNG24和PNG32是个问题,所以就来挖掘了一下,从国外网站上看到一篇文章,现在就明朗了,也顺便给拿过来翻译了一下。以下是译文:

如果你曾经用过Fireworks,你就会知道它的图片格式列表中包含“PNG32”这个文件格式。但是它是什么?为什么Photoshop没有提供这一选项的支持呢?

——————————————————————————————

PNG图片格式现在包含三种类型:

1.PNG8

2.PNG24

3.PNG32

如果你经常使用Photoshop,那你这里就会问了:到底PNG32是个什么东西。基本上PNG32就是PNG24,但是附带了全alpha通道。就是说每个像素上不仅存储了24位真色彩信息还存储了8位的alpha通道信息,就如同GIF能存储透明和不透明信息一样。当我们把图片放到不太搭配的背景上的时候,透明PNG图片的边缘会显示得更加平滑。

当然,我也知道你的想法,“但是Photoshop也能生成带透明通道的PNG图片!”我也知道,它只是表面上这么说是PNG24,让我也产生困惑了。

作为一个伤感的Fireworks倡导者,我只使用PNG32支持附带alpha通道的真色彩图片。不管怎样,如果你习惯使用Photoshop,你就应该知道,Photoshop在“存储为WEB格式”中只提供PNG8和PNG24两种PNG格式。

我敢肯定你经常会勾选“支持透明”选项,以获得带有透明度的PNG图片,但是这样你就获取了一张PNG32图片。——Photoshop只是觉得把PNG32这个名称给隐藏掉了。奇怪吧?……

原文链接


类别:默认分类| |分享到i贴吧|浏览(1132)|评论 (0)
 
网友评论:
发表评论:
姓 名:
网址或邮箱: (选填)
内 容:
     

   
帮助中心 | 空间客服 | 投诉中心 | 空间协议
©2012 Baidu